Abstract
The acquisition to atmospheric parameters accurately, is important in practice. There are a lot of disadvantages in old detecting methods. A new method of remotely measuring wind & atmospheric temperature is given in the paper by combining acoustic and radar techniques, The theory to this method is discussed in detail. A advanced PMC interface and DSP technologies is used in developing the whole digit measurement platform. In the end the signal processing technique is set forth correspondingly.
